Single phase gamma TiAl alloys have been confirmed to show an anomalous flow stress maximum at temperatures 400--600 C. The dislocation mechanisms responsible for this variation of flow stress with temperature are still not clear, with several mechanisms being proposed. The present report discusses static strain aging experiments carried out on two-phase TiAl-based alloy and considers the relation of the strain aging observed to studies of activation volume and anomalous flow stress increases.
